Exploring Owatonna's Historic Downtown

Owatonna, Minnesota is a city with a rich history. Founded in 1853, it was originally a small farming community. But over the years, it has grown into a thriving city with a population of over 24,000 people. This video shows footage of Owatonna's downtown area, which is full of historic buildings.

Owatonna is home to a number of historical and cultural attractions, including the Steele County Historical Society Museum and the Owatonna Arts Center. The city also has a number of parks and recreation areas, making it a great place to live, work, and raise a family.

Lakeville, MN - Minnesota’s 10th Most Populous City - City Drive Thru

Lakeville /ˈleɪkvɪl/ is an exurb of Minneapolis-Saint Paul, and the largest city in Dakota County, Minnesota, United States. It is approximately 20 miles (32 km) south of both downtown Minneapolis and downtown St. Paul[5] along Interstate Highway 35. Starting as a flourishing milling center, its agriculture industry and other major industries are still in operation. Lakeville is one of the fastest-growing cities in the Twin Cities area.[6] The population was 69,490 at the 2020 census.[2] making it Minnesota's tenth most populous city.

Experience Owatonna | Explore the Minnesota State Public School Orphanage

10,000 orphaned, abandoned or abused children were sent to Owatonna between 1886 and 1945 to live at the Minnesota State Public School for Dependent and Neglected Children, located on what is now called the West Hills Campus. This is the only known Orphanage Museum in the nation. The museum was founded by a former “State-Schooler” to remember the children who lived there.

Experience Owatonna | Louis Sullivan's First Jewel Box of the Prairie Bank

Take an inside look at Louis Sullivan's biggest and most elaborate Jewel Box of the Prairie Bank. You will experience awe-inspiring and spirit-lifting architecture. This is the first of Sullivan’s eight jewel box banks. Historian Tom Martinson calls it “one of the greatest buildings in American history.”

Northfield, MN | A 4K Jefferson Highway City Walking Tour

Along the banks of the Cannon River lies charming Northfield, Minnesota. With its 150 years of history, art, culture and education, Northfield offers something for everyone. Northfield was platted in 1856 by John W. North. Local legend says that the town was named for John North and a Mr. Field. North, realizing that the town straddled the proposed northern border of Rice county, went to the state capital to lobby to move the border one mile north. Northfield was founded by settlers from New England known as Yankees as part of New England's colonization of what was then the far west. It was an early agricultural center with many wheat and corn farms. The town also supported lumber and flour mills powered by the Cannon River. The city's motto, Cows, Colleges, and Contentment, reflects the influence of the dairy farms as well as its two liberal arts colleges.
